Why did you choose Inter? Your will has always been clear.
I had other offers, but my will has always been clear. The coach introduced me to the project, his words convinced me and now I want to help the club return to high levels. Although there were other opportunities, I have always and only wanted Inter.”
How did San Siro effect you, waiting of the official debut?
“I was impressed by the fans on my arrival, it was a unique experience and I’ll never forget it. I will also remember the first steps with the coach and my teammates. I can’t wait to play and make my debut.”
What did you learn from players like Ribery and Robben during your experience at Bayern Munich?
“I think every player is different from the next, even if I don’t like comparisons. Each one has its own characteristics, even though I had the chance to play with great players at Bayern Munich. I will try to build on all the things I have learned to be useful here Inter, hoping to get back to winning with this team.”
At Bayern Munich you lost the smile? In your opinion, what is your best shot?
“I was not totally happy and everyone became aware of this. Now I want to get back to playing and only by doing that I can be happy, being able to prove myself. I’m hungry to win and I want to go do it with Inter. The feelings are good, I am sure that we will return to high levels.”
How close were you to Juventus? Is the third place possible?
“Reading the newspapers it seems as if I have had contacts with many teams, but my brother has worked very hard. Juventus, of course, was one of the options. But I only wanted Inter, I can’t wait to play, and the third place is within our reach. We got points during the weekend and I’m sure we can get back up.”
Did you ask anyone for information on Inter before speaking with Mancini?
“There was no need to talk to anyone, Inter is known by all and the history of this club speaks for itself. Inter has won everything and great players have played here. My brother has a very good relationship with Piero Ausilio, so there wasn’t any kind of problem.”
Do you think that you, with your arrival, will bring more Albanians fans to the stadium? How do you feel physically? Do you think you’re ready for the next game?
“I realized that there are a lot of Albanian fans of Inter. I was born in Kosovo, ‘twin’ of Albania. Inter has fans all over the world and this is something I have known for some time. The Inter fans are not only Albanians. I trained all week with the team, I hope to play and I have positive feelings.”
How do you think you will be able to deal with a difficult championship like the Italian one?
“In football you can’t make personal plans, we go on the pitch to do the best and win. We are Inter and we have always have to think about reaching as high as we can. I want to be in a winning club, I will try to give my contribution. It will not be easy to always win, but we’ll try.”
Did Rummenigge tell you about Inter?
“No, it wasn’t necessary to talk to him. Inter is known to everyone, it was clearly my will and I want to return to the top with this shirt.”
FcIN – Before making the final decision, did you get to confront Guardiola? What differences have you noticed between the ‘Giuseppe Meazza’ and the ‘Allianz Arena’?
“I talked a little with the Spanish coach, he knew that my intention was to change clubs. As for the arenas, there are differences: San Siro is beautiful, but the bad thing in Italy is the attendance numbers. I hope those things can change with good football.”
The Inter fans have expressed their enthusiasm also through social networks, what do you think about that? What fascinates you in Italian football?
“Ausilio told me everything, it’s nice to know that the fans wanted me so much and I realized this also against Genoa. In Italy you don’t score as much as in the Bundesliga, but we want to play a good football and try to score the highest possible number of goals.”
Despite the big offers, what prompted you to choose Inter? Considering that Italian football is going through a difficult period.
“I think that when a player chooses a club he also considers the effort that was made by the club. This also led me to choose Inter. I wanted to change the country, but now the results count in order to get Inter to the top.”
A winger or attacking midfielder in 4-2-3-1: what is the favorite position?
“At Bayern I proved my versatility, now it’s up to Mancini choose the best role for me. Personally I prefer the position as playmaker, but any position is fine.”
